Digital Radiography and 3D Imaging



Digital radiography and 3D imaging are revolutionizing the area of pediatric dental care, allowing for more precise and effective medical diagnoses and treatment planning. With digital radiography, traditional X-ray films are changed by electronic sensing units that record images of teeth and bordering frameworks. This innovation offers many benefits, such as reduced radiation direct exposure and instant photo availability.

By removing the demand for movie processing, digital radiography conserves time and enhances process in a pediatric dental practice. In addition, 3D imaging supplies a three-dimensional sight of a kid's mouth, enabling dental professionals to evaluate dental anomalies, review orthodontic therapy needs, and prepare for complicated procedures with better precision.

This advanced imaging modern technology enhances the overall high quality of care supplied to young individuals, making it a necessary device in modern pediatric dental care.

Virtual Reality in Pediatric Dentistry



Pediatric dentistry has integrated virtual reality technology to improve the oral experience for young patients.

By immersing youngsters in an online world during their oral gos to, dental experts aim to minimize stress and anxiety and worry connected with oral treatments. With virtual reality headsets, kids can be carried to a fun and interesting environment, such as an undersea journey or a wonderful woodland. This distraction technique helps to divert their attention from the dental procedures, reducing anxiety and improving their overall experience.



Moreover, virtual reality can additionally be used for educational functions, permitting youngsters to get more information regarding oral health and dental treatment in an interactive and entertaining way. By incorporating virtual reality right into pediatric dental care, oral brows through come to be extra pleasurable and less frightening for kids, promoting better dental wellness routines and long-term oral care.
